1. xSuit 4.0

Our top pick for travel: machine washable, wrinkle-resistant, genuinely comfortable—and worth it at $499.

What we liked: Machine washable; 8-way stretch fabric with wrinkle resistance; Affordable at $499.

What we’d skip: Heavier weight than some alternatives; Branded buttons won't appeal to everyone.

2. Bluffworks Suit

Machine-washable travel suit that looks like real menswear while hiding 10 pockets without cargo-gear appearance.

What we liked: Machine washable & wrinkle-resistant; Hides 10 pockets without looking like cargo gear; Looks like genuine wool blazer, not technical material.

What we’d skip: Sizing runs small—size up from standard suit brands.

3. xSuit 5.0

The xSuit 5.0 is our top pick for frequent travelers who need a suit that survives long flights without dry-cleaning.

What we liked: Machine-washable (no dry-cleaning required); 30% better wrinkle resistance than xSuit 4.0; TechWool fabric with 8-way stretch and wool-like appearance.
